Understanding the Effects of Low pH in Water

If you’ve noticed signs like a blue-green staining on your copper pipes or a noticeable metallic taste in your drinking water, it may be time to investigate further. Acidic water can lead to a range of issues:

  • Corrosion of pipes and plumbing systems
  • Decreased efficiency of water heaters
  • Unpleasant tastes and odors in drinking water
  • Increased maintenance costs over time

Addressing Low pH with pH Neutralization Technology

pH neutralization systems are designed to correct acidic water issues effectively. These systems typically involve the use of minerals such as calcite, which balances the pH by dissolving into the water and raising its pH levels. This natural process can prevent corrosion and improve water quality for a more pleasant taste.

Choosing the Right Equipment for Your Needs

When considering a pH neutralization system, sizing is crucial. Key factors include:

  • Flow Rate: The volume of water used in your household will determine the necessary flow rate of the system. Calculate your household's daily water usage to establish this.
  • Grain Capacity: This refers to the system's ability to handle a specific volume of water before needing replenishment. Evaluate how often you'll need to refill based on your usage and the mineral source.
  • Gallons Per Day (GPD): This figure will usually dictate the size of the tank you need, depending on your home’s water consumption trends.
  • Tank Size: The size of the tank will correlate with your family size, water consumption, and the frequency of maintenance.

Understanding pH Levels in Water

pH levels in water indicate its acidity or alkalinity, which plays a crucial role in determining water safety and compatibility with plumbing systems. The pH scale ranges from 0 to 14, with 7 being neutral. Values below 7 denote acidic water, while values above 7 indicate alkaline water. Monitoring and adjusting your water's pH is essential for health and maintenance.

Impact of Low pH Water on Plumbing

When water has a low pH, it can cause significant damage to plumbing fixtures and appliances. The acidic nature of low pH water leads to corrosion, which can result in pinhole leaks, reduced water flow, and a shorter lifespan for pipes. Additionally, acidic water can release harmful metals such as lead and copper from plumbing systems, posing health risks.

Health Effects of Acidic Water

Drinking water with a low pH can affect health in various ways. While mildly acidic water is generally safe to consume, long-term exposure to significantly low pH levels may lead to gastrointestinal irritation and other health-related issues. It’s best to keep pH levels within the safe range (6.5 to 8.5) for human consumption.

Options for Testing Water pH

To ensure your water quality is safe, testing its pH is critical. Here are some methods for testing water pH:

  • pH Test Strips: A simple and cost-effective option, these strips change color based on the pH level.
  • Digital pH Meters: More accurate and user-friendly, these devices provide instant readings of pH levels.
  • Lab Testing Kits: For thorough analysis, samples can be sent to certified labs for professional testing.

The Role of Water Softeners

Water softeners can indirectly affect pH levels in your home’s water supply. While their primary function is to remove hardness minerals like calcium and magnesium, some systems can also alkalize water slightly. However, it’s essential to verify if your specific softener impacts pH and whether it is compatible with your pH neutralization strategy.
